कॉलोनी गेट का भुट्टा

कॉलोनी गेट का भुट्टा

यह कॉमिक उत्तर/मध्य भारतीय शहरी मानसून की एक बहुत पहचानी जाने वाली शाम को पकड़ती है: सोसाइटी गेट पर लौटती हुई भुट्टे की गाड़ी। कहानी का हास्य किसी दुर्घटना या प्रतीक्षा से नहीं, बल्कि स्वाद, आदेश, रिश्तेदारी, बालकनी से दिए जाने वाले निर्देश, बच्चों की अतिरिक्त नींबू-मिर्च मांग, और “हम बस नीचे होकर आते हैं” वाली घरेलू सच्चाई से आता है। भुट्टा यहाँ सिर्फ स्नैक नहीं है; यह बरसात, मोहल्ले, और रविवार की ढलती शाम का सामाजिक पासवर्ड है। दृश्य में गीली सड़क, कोयले की आंच, अखबार में लिपटे भुट्टे, सिक्योरिटी गेट, ऊपर झुकी बालकनियाँ, और अलग-अलग पीढ़ियों की छोटी-छोटी पसंद शामिल हैं।

जुलाई की हल्की बरसाती रविवार-शाम में एक शहरी हाउसिंग सोसाइटी के गेट पर भुट्टे की गाड़ी आती है। पूरा मोहल्ला अपने-अपने बहानों के साथ नीचे उतर आता है—कोई सिर्फ दो भुट्टे खरीदने, कोई नमक-नींबू का अनुपात बताने, कोई बच्चों के लिए कम मिर्च का ऑर्डर देने, और कोई चार फ्लैटों के लिए पार्सल बनवाने आता है। धीरे-धीरे यह सिर्फ नाश्ता खरीदने का दृश्य नहीं रह जाता, बल्कि पूरे मौसम के शुरू होने का सामुदायिक संकेत बन जाता है। पड़ोसियों के बीच हल्के-फुल्के बातचीत, बच्चों की खुशियाँ, और भुट्टे की सुगंध से भरी शाम एक अलग ही माहौल बना देती है।
